In standard philosophical manner, we must first look at counter-examples, at that of which intelligence does not properly consist. Consider the Intelligence Quotient, the “I.Q.” What is the I.Q.? The I.Q. is simply a number which denotes the ratio of a given person’s performance on the I.Q. test to the average performance of others on the same test. In other words, the thorough-going empiricist would say that intelligence is that which the I.Q. test measures. But this is just being circular. The nature of intelligence itself is not engaged.
In the same way, dictionary definitions of intelligence are likewise circular. For example, The Concise Oxford Dictionary defines “intelligence” as “intellect, understanding” but defines “intellect” as “the faculty of knowing & reasoning; reasoning,” so we’re back where we started.
